A Portland must! Usually a long line-up. Eclectic store with a huge variety of doughnuts and long johns with not much time to process when you get inside, but don't worry - whatever you choose will be very good. It's in a seedy part of town, but that seems part of the Portland experience and safe, as long as you are careful.

If you are thinking of coming here because of the hype don't, their quality has slipped drastically once they got famous. On my most recent visit the doughnuts were some of the worst I've had, but they used to be really good. If you only care about how you doughnut looks come here. Other than that you can get doughnuts of similar quality at Safeway, or better doughnuts at literally any other shop around. The wait time is long, they only take cash, and the doughnuts are not even that good, avoid this place. Huge disappointment to see another company get famous and stop caring about quality.
